This book presents a very useful and readable collection of chapters in nanotechnologies for energy conversion, storage, and utilization, offering new results which are sure to be of interest to researchers, students, and engineers in the field of nanotechnologies and energy. Readers will find energy systems and nanotechnology very useful in many ways such as generation of energy policy, waste management, nanofluid preparation and numerical modelling, energy storage, and many other energy-related areas. It is also useful as reference book for many energy and nanofluid-related courses being taken up by graduate and undergraduate students. In particular, this book provides insights into various forms of renewable energy, such as biogas, solar energy, photovoltaic, solar cells, and solar thermal energy storage. Also, it deals with the CFD simulations of various aspects of nanofluids/hybrid nanofluids.
